Holidays on November 1st 2022

International: All Saints' Day

Pope Boniface IV dedicated the day as a holiday to honour the Blessed Virgin Mary and all martyrs

Algeria: Anniversary of the Revolution

Marks the birth of the National Liberation Front in 1954 and the start of the Algerian War

Antigua and Barbuda: Independence Day

Commemorates Antigua and Barbuda's independence from the UK on November 1st 1981

Australia (regional): Melbourne Cup Day

Known as 'the race that stops a nation', the Melbourne Cup is the most prestigious horse race in Australia

Bhutan: Coronation day of His Majesty the King

A public coronation ceremony for His Majesty Jigme Khesar Namgyel Wangchuck was held on 1 November 2008

Regional

India (regional): Haryana Day

Commemorates the day when the state of Haryana was carved out of Punjab in 1966

Regional

India (regional): Kannada Rajyothsava

All the Kannada speaking regions of south India were merged to form the state of Karnataka on Nov 1st 1956

Regional

India (regional): Puducherry Liberation Day

The de facto transfer or merger of Puducherry and other French colonies with India came into effect on November 1st 1954

Regional

India (regional): Kut

A harvest festival of the different tribes of Kuki-Chin-Mizo groups of Manipur

Regional

India (regional): Igas

Celebrated 11 days in Uttarakhand after the Diwali festival.

Israel: Public Holiday

Election days in Israel are national holidays, a measure aimed at encouraging participation

US Virgin Islands: D. Hamilton Jackson Day

In honor of a noted labor rights advocate in the Danish West Indies.

On this Day in History
1973 - The Indian state of Mysore is renamed as Karnataka to represent all the regions within Karunadu.
1956 - The Indian states Kerala, Andhra Pradesh, and Mysore State are formally created under the States Reorganisation Act.
1928 - The Law on the Adoption and Implementation of the Turkish Alphabet, replacing the version of the Arabic alphabet previously used with the Latin alphabet, comes into force in Turkey.
1611 - William Shakespeare's play The Tempest is performed for the first time, at Whitehall Palace in London.
